Support a New Journal!
Padva asks support for sexuality journal
FSD member Gilad Padva (Tel Aviv U) would like for FSD members and others to send letters encouraging the reinstatement of a successful journal just suspended by its publisher for "financial reasons." The Journal of Sexuality and Gender Studies - formerly the Journal of Gay, Lesbian and Bisexual Identity - was published for seven years by Kluwer Academic/Human Sciences Press. Gilad characterizes the journal as a "fruitful and highly illuminating intellectual work."
  
Gilad asks FSD members to send letters that "encourage and support the journal's wonderful scholar editor," Professor Warren Blumenfeld at Wblumenfeld@mail.colgate.edu in his bid to have the journal resume publication.
  
By the way, those with access to this journal will want to check out Gilad's article in the last chapter, "Heavenly Monsters: Male Bodies, Fantasies and Identifications in the Naked Issue of Attitude Magazine". International Journal of Sexuality and Gender Studies, Vol. 7, No. 4, October 2002 (pp. 281-292).
